How they compare

Papua New Guinea currently reports 3,904 against 3,867 in Sweden, a difference of 37.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 23 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Sweden ahead.

Papua New Guinea ranks 96th and Sweden ranks 98th of 188 countries.

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Papua New Guinea Sweden Difference Ahead
2000s 1,961 3,328 1,367 Sweden
2010s 2,633 3,569 935.95 Sweden
2020s 3,567 3,776 209.63 Sweden

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Imputed observations are not based on national data, are subject to high uncertainty and should not be used for country comparisons or rankings. This series is based on the 13th ICLS definitions. This indicator refers to total weekly hours actually worked for employed persons in their main job divided by 40 or 48.
